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Bagaimana cara mendapatkan hasil di 2 tabel?

Gunakan INNER JOIN dasar untuk mencapai itu.

SELECT b.*
FROM booking b INNER JOIN room r USING(RoomID)
WHERE @date_input BETWEEN startdate AND enddate AND size = @size_input;

Ubah @date_input dan @size_input untuk masukan Anda yang sebenarnya.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. persentil oleh COUNT(DISTINCT) dengan WHERE berkorelasi hanya berfungsi dengan tampilan (atau tanpa DISTINCT)

  2. berikan variabel javascript ke php mysql pilih kueri

  3. Bagaimana cara memasukkan nilai dalam array PHP ke tabel MySQL?

  4. Masalah dengan RODBC sqlSave

  5. Apa yang salah dengan pernyataan MySQL ini:DECLARE @ID INT